Transaction 6867274bc8e8ed4677c176bafeb270e127470d1088970bb66c2abd0a02f33409

2 Input
2 Outputs
  • 6867274bc8e8ed4677c176bafeb270e127470d1088970bb66c2abd0a02f33409:0
  • value  300000
    address  1QA7C16qPBL1YUn9ekkBHaQNtszEtA6pjw
  • 6867274bc8e8ed4677c176bafeb270e127470d1088970bb66c2abd0a02f33409:1
  • value  226792
    address  3H6qGahiUvayEZEJbG6WQGLxdKAH98ApiC